Until the late 1930s, stock car racing took place as a series of unofficial meetings, still redolent of the early years when the sport was nothing more than exuberant rivalry between drivers evading the federal revenue agents around the mountain roads and foothills of the Appalachians with trunks full of moonshine. It is said that the very first race took place in 1937 at the aptly named Stockbridge in Georgia, but many dispute this as being a myth. Whatever its origins, and the part played by the bootleggers, the National Association of Stock Car Auto Racing was born in 1948 as an amalgamation of drivers and manufacturers formed by the major racing figures of the day.Those that collect NASCAR hats and other memorabilia naturally prefer to get their hands on any gear or mementoes from these days onwards, and while they sometimes appear in yard and garage sales, the genuine articles are more likely to be found in antique stores and online. However, they can be very expensive to buy, and many prefer simply to collect modern-day gear that is available on eBay and occasionally from Amazon. For example, take Dale Jarrett NASCAR hats. You will find hats in any sports store with the name Dale Jarrett on them, and you can also buy them online at eBay for under $10. But is that what you really want? Most people would prefer something better than that, particularly if they were collecting memorabilia, and while a monogrammed ball hat is good, it would be a lot better to have an authentic NASCAR hat than any old hat with a logo or name printed or embroidered on it. Most genuine stock car fans would probably prefer a vintage NASCAR hat that had been worn by a real driver, and if that's you then where can you find these hats, caps and snapbacks? It can take a long time hunting round memorabilia stores, although you might strike lucky if you can get within touching distance of a driver during practice, or even near his home if you are lucky to live in the neighborhood. Many stock car drivers get annoyed when approached in that way, but might let you have one of the old caps he has finished with.It is far easier to stay at home and surf through eBay. You can often find pretty good deals using online auction sites, and as this page was written there was an authentic NASCAR hat on sale for $129.97 (eBay 'Buy it Now' price) of year 2000 vintage, signed by Dale Jarrett and coming with an SP Certificate of Authenticity. There are many more where that came from, and you can find a wide range of NASCAR gear online, including monogrammed jackets and ball caps.
